#9f744c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9f744c is composed of 62.4% red, 45.5%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 27% magenta, 52.2%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 28.9 degrees, a saturation of 35.3% and a lightness of 46.1%. #9f744c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e898 with #3f0000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

Shades and Tints of #9f744c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0906 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#9f744c is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#7c7c7c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#837a72 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#8e8358 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#9d7d54 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#a7767e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#947d53 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#9e7a51 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#a4756b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
